History

Burkitt worked as a fitter and turner for the Colonial Sugar Refining Co before joining the Australian Imperial Force in 1916 and serving in Egypt and France. After the war ended he returned to the Colonial Sugar Refining Co at Pyrmont. He later moved to the company's drawing office at O'Connell Street, Sydney where he became Chief Refinery Design Engineer. He retired from this position in 1953 and was later employed by MacDonald Wagner & Biddle as an engineer overseeing bulk grain storage and shipment at Newcastle and Geelong. He spent time in Hawaii observing bulk sugar handling. He was employed as site engineer and then manager of the first Australian bulk sugar terminal in Mackay from 1957 until 1959 when he retired. Burkitt died later that year.
